- keshav rathiDec 24, 2021 · 4 years agoSure! Bear spreads are a popular hedging strategy used by traders in the cryptocurrency market to protect against price declines. A bear spread involves simultaneously buying put options at a specific strike price and selling put options at a lower strike price. This strategy allows traders to profit from a decrease in the price of the underlying cryptocurrency while limiting potential losses. By using bear spreads, traders can hedge their positions and mitigate the risk of price declines in the volatile cryptocurrency market.
